I notice that no matter what advertiser or network I work with, after a few weeks of solid epc with email/zip submit offers they eventually drop to around $0.01 instead of $0.20ish at the beginning. anyone else notice this?

is there a rule of thumb i can use to prevent this, say only making $10.00 a day instead of 30, and spreading the traffic around to other networks?

    The problem is probably the quality of your leads... email/zip submits always tend to have a higher scrub rate in comparison with other lead gen offers, but if your leads generate good money on the back-end you may get better numbers.

    Anyway, rotating networks can be a very good idea when working with this type of offer, and it's also easy, since many networks have the most popular email/zip submits.
